FREE RADICALS

Although free radical generation leading to direct oxidative damage to cellular components
remains a common postulated mechanism of AIC, there are alternative proposed mechanisms
that probably contribute to cardiac dysfunction. Anthracycline compounds have a planar
structure, which intercalates into the DNA through noncovalent interaction, preventing further
DNA and RNA synthesis and likely contributing to the death of myocytes and mitochondrial
mutations. Anthracyclines disrupt DNA by poisoning topoisomerase, a critical enzyme for
unwinding of the DNA for replication and synthesis, thereby causing growth arrest and
programmed cell death.
